Why Roof Leaks Occur
Roof leaks often occur due to a combination of factors, including weather conditions, poor installation, and lack of maintenance. In Corpus Christi, the coastal climate can exacerbate these issues, making it essential to take proactive steps to prevent leaks.
Common Causes of Roof Leaks
Several factors contribute to roof leaks, and being aware of them can help you take preventive measures:
- Weather Damage: High winds, heavy rains, and storms can weaken roof materials.
- Poor Installation: Improperly installed roofing systems are more susceptible to leaks.
- Age of the Roof: Older roofs may develop cracks and wear over time.
- Clogged Gutters: Blocked gutters can cause water to pool and seep under shingles.
- Flashing Issues: Damaged or improperly installed flashing around chimneys and vents can lead to leaks.
Homeowners in Corpus Christi should be particularly vigilant about these issues due to the area's unique weather conditions.
Regular Roof Inspections
Conducting regular roof inspections is vital for preventing leaks. Aim for at least two inspections per year, ideally in spring and fall. During these inspections, check for:
- Cracked or missing shingles
- Damaged flashing
- Signs of water pooling
- Debris accumulation in gutters

Proper Roof Maintenance
Maintaining your roof is essential for preventing leaks. Here are some tips for effective roof maintenance:
- Clear Debris: Regularly remove leaves, branches, and other debris from your roof and gutters.
- Check for Algae and Moss: In humid areas like Corpus Christi, algae and moss can grow on roofs, trapping moisture.
- Seal Cracks: Use roofing sealant to fill any cracks or gaps in your roofing material.
- Trim Overhanging Branches: Keep tree branches away from your roof to prevent damage and debris accumulation.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. How can I tell if my roof is leaking? Look for water stains on ceilings or walls, dampness in the attic, or missing shingles.
2. What is the average cost of roof leak repair? In 2026, typical costs range from $300 to $1,500, depending on the extent of the damage.
3. How often should I inspect my roof? Inspect your roof at least twice a year and after severe weather events.
4. Can I repair a roof leak myself? Minor leaks can sometimes be fixed with sealants, but it's safer to hire professionals for significant issues.
5. How long does a roof inspection take? A thorough roof inspection usually takes 1-2 hours, depending on the roof's size and condition.
